Yangtse, Tiger Leaping Gorge  
   

Yangtse, Tiger Leaping Gorge

I'm not sure of the vertical range in this picture but I think it is ~2000m. The highest point of the mountains, probably not visible, is 5500m whilst the Yangtse is ~2500m at this point.
